The Belgian traffic? Almost entirely from a single residential IP — one box that sent over 156,000 login attempts, more than the entire country of Germany. It just sat there, hammering echo "\x6F\x6B" over and over, every single second, for weeks. Relentless.
Had a funny similar thing, there's some weird person/people that randomly probe and attack a specific game's community hosted dedicated servers; and one week this specific IP address out of Virginia was just hammering one of mine, with what amounts to a specific byte sequence, then an incrementing number of the packet (until it wrapped around). Then it stopped. Weird shit.
It's possible it was something misconfigured, a poorly-written script, or a bug in some software causing unexpected behavior. At the scale of the Internet, all of those are very possible.
It could also be the Internet equivalent of a numbers station.
It's was a pretty specific non standard port on UDP. It's not even doing proper scanning since the byte sequence used isn't one that would trigger a response challenge/ack. My guess is someone trying to DOS using an older byte sequence that used to choke/kill the server software on older versions.
